GRAPE ‘FREDONIA’ / GRAPE ‘FREDONIA’
Sweet, Juicy Grapes for Fresh Eating and Preserves
Grape ‘Fredonia’ is a popular, high-quality variety known for its large, sweet, and juicy blue-black grapes. With a rich flavor that balances sweetness and tartness, ‘Fredonia’ is perfect for fresh consumption, juices, and making jellies or jams. Its robust vines produce heavy yields, making it an excellent choice for gardeners seeking both an attractive and productive grapevine.
Why Choose Grape ‘Fredonia’?
Comparison: ‘Fredonia’ is a standout among table grapes for its excellent flavor and large fruit. The berries have a rich, full taste that is both sweet and slightly tart, and the vine is known for producing large clusters of fruit. Compared to other grape varieties, ‘Fredonia’ is also more cold-hardy, thriving in cooler climates where other grapes may struggle.
Companions: Grapes like ‘Fredonia’ do well when planted alongside other fruits such as apples, pears, and berries. Companion plants that enjoy full sun and have similar water needs, like herbs or flowers, will also complement the grapevine well.
Key Features:
Large, Sweet Berries: ‘Fredonia’ produces large, blue-black grapes with a sweet, rich flavor, perfect for fresh eating or preserving.
Heavy Yields: This variety is known for its abundant fruit production, providing plenty of grapes to enjoy throughout the growing season.
Cold-Hardy: ‘Fredonia’ is well-suited to USDA zones 5–8, making it an excellent option for gardeners in cooler climates.
Disease-Resistant: This variety is relatively resistant to common grapevine diseases, making it easier to maintain.
Attractive Vine: The ‘Fredonia’ vine is hardy and produces dark green leaves, making it an attractive choice for trellises, fences, or arbors.
Specifications:
Harvest Time: Late summer to early fall.
Plant Size: 3–6 m tall, depending on vine training.
Hardiness: Zone 5–8.
